How much diesel does a Webasto heater use per hour?
How much fuel does a Webasto heater need per hour? Of course, the fuel consumption is strongly depending on the needed heating power and type of heater. As very rough and noncommittal proportion a heater needs 100 ml diesel per hour and kW. For further details, please see the heater’s technical specifications.

How does Webasto heater work?
Webasto Coolant Heaters circulate the machines coolant over a heat exchanger and then pumps it back through the engine and HVAC system. The result is a pre-heated engine and interior. In extreme climates, the heater can be used with additional accessories to warm the fuel, hydraulic fluid and batteries.
Which is better Eberspacher or Webasto?
Eberspacher is generally more expensive than the equivalent Webasto heater. Fuel Metering Pump: Webasto have introduced a new fuel quieter fuel pump so in this area they are now the same. Eberspacher heaters have 4 heat settings, with the Webasto having only 3 heat settings.
Does Webasto drain battery?
Originally Answered: Is Webasto car heating system can drain out your car battery? If working and installed as supposed: no. But keep in mind the system tests the battery charge level before starting the heating. In case your battery is low, the system won’t start.

How much electricity does a Webasto heater use?
Fuel Consumption: 0.13 to 0.27 l/h. Rated voltage: 12 V. Operating voltage range: 10 – 15 V. Rated power input: 14 – 29 Watt.
How much gas does a Webasto use?
Webasto Heating Solution Benefits: Low cost of operation over time. Saves engine wear and tear and maintenance cost related to extended idling. Highly fuel efficient, runs up to 22 Hours on a single gallon of fuel compared to an idling engine consuming approximately . 8 gallons per hour.
